Kuppa Koffee

Background

Kuppa Koffee opened in September of 2005. We are located in a very small town - Covington, IN. There wasn't anything like it in town and I wanted to bring a little bit of the big city to a small town. It has been very well received! We renovated what was the old Covington City Building. It was masked as an office space with paneling on the walls and drop ceilings. We basically brought the old building back to life, the best find was the tin ceilings which were still in fairly good condition. We feature a drive-thru as well, which helps our business considerably. It has been fun educating people on the different types of coffee drinks and chai tea, we now have a Starbucks located in Danville, IL (about 15 miles away) and we get a lot of comments about how they like our drinks better! Gotta love living in a small town!! It's been a little over two years, we're going strong and loving it!

Challenges Faced

It's a very small town. Even if we were the greatest in everything we did, it still would be difficult to increase sales. The town only has 3,000 people so we're constantly trying to create/add different things and keep up with our marketing. Staying competitively priced within our area but still making enough of a profit (still working on that one!)
